Six work-streams Twin Eagle coordinates on every build
Site Survey, Path Study & RF Planning
Every turn-key tower project Twin Eagle Solutions coordinates begins with a physical site survey, a path study against existing or proposed wireless infrastructure, RF coverage modeling, and a structural-load analysis of the proposed antenna and equipment loading. We document soil, access, drainage, ROW, set-backs, FAA Part 77 obstruction analysis, and tower-class selection (self-support lattice, monopole, guyed mast, or tilt-down) before a single piece of steel is engineered. Our engineering partners provide stamped drawings; Twin Eagle owns the program.
Engineering, Permitting & Geotech
Twin Eagle Solutions coordinates the structural engineering, geotechnical investigation, foundation design, and permitting work that has to land before steel can come out of the yard. TIA-222 Rev. H is the controlling structural standard; ACI 318 governs the foundation; the IBC governs the building code; FAA AC 70/7460-1 governs marking and lighting; FCC ASR registration is filed when required. Local AHJ permitting, environmental review, NEPA where applicable, and SHPO/THPO consultations are all tracked under the same project plan.
Vendor & Sub-Contractor Coordination
Twin Eagle Solutions does not erect heavy steel in-house. We coordinate the entire build with vetted, insured tower-erection contractors and engineering firms that we have qualified, audited, and worked with on prior projects. The customer signs one contract with Twin Eagle. We manage the engineer, the geotech, the steel fabricator, the foundation crew, the erection crew, the lineman, the antenna installer, the inspector, and the AHJ inspections — and we manage them on your timeline, with regular customer status updates and one accountable point of contact.
Foundation, Anchors & Erection
Concrete pours, anchor bolt sets, guy-anchor installation, and the structural raise are scheduled and supervised by Twin Eagle on-site, with QA documentation captured for the customer record. The actual erection crane and rigging crew is a Twin Eagle-qualified sub-contractor with documented OSHA 1926 Subpart CC and Subpart M compliance, current insurance, and a documented safety program. Plumb-and-twist verification, bolt torque records, and as-built dimensions are captured before lighting and antennas go up.
Lighting, Grounding, Antennas & Comms
Once the structure is up and signed off, Twin Eagle's in-house climbers and aerial-lift crews install FAA obstruction lighting per AC 70/7460-1, the lightning protection system per IEC 62305 and IEEE 1100, the ground ring and bonding system per the NEC, the coax / waveguide / fiber transmission lines, and the antennas, microwave, and radios — sweep-tested and link-budget verified. The site is left RF-ready for whichever Twin Eagle wireless or carrier system is being commissioned on top.
Commissioning, Walkdown & As-Builts
Every turn-key build closes out with a single final walkdown, a complete as-built documentation package, RF sweep reports, structural inspection records, FAA marking/lighting verification, FCC ASR registration confirmation when applicable, photo documentation, and the warranty handoff. The customer gets one binder (digital and physical), one accountable contact for the duration of the warranty, and a tower that is ready for service from day one.

Frequently asked questions about turn-key tower builds
What is a turn-key tower build?
A turn-key tower build is a single-contract program in which Twin Eagle Solutions coordinates the entire delivery of a new communications tower — site survey, RF and path study, structural and foundation engineering, geotech, permitting, foundation, steel erection, lighting, grounding, antenna and radio installation, sweep testing, FAA/FCC compliance, and commissioning — under one project manager and one final walkdown. The customer signs one contract; Twin Eagle manages every other party on the project.
Does Twin Eagle Solutions erect tower steel in-house?
No. Twin Eagle Solutions does not erect heavy tower steel in-house. We coordinate the steel erection with vetted, insured tower-erection sub-contractors that we have qualified and worked with previously. Twin Eagle remains the customer's single point of contact and the responsible project manager from kickoff through commissioning, but the actual rigging and crane work is performed by qualified erection crews under Twin Eagle's coordination.
How do you select erection sub-contractors?
Erection sub-contractors are selected against documented OSHA 1926 Subpart CC (cranes) and Subpart M (fall protection) compliance, current general liability and workers' compensation insurance, certified and rescue-trained climbers, a documented safety program, and verifiable prior experience on the tower class being erected. Twin Eagle maintains a qualified vendor list and audits documentation before mobilization.
What types of structures do you coordinate?
Self-supporting lattice towers, guyed masts, monopoles, tilt-down poles, rooftop steel, water-tank-mounted antennas, and structural reinforcement of existing towers. Heights typically range from 80 to 400 feet for new builds, with engineered loading sized against the antenna and equipment program.
How long does a turn-key tower build take?
From kickoff to commissioning, a typical greenfield self-support tower runs 12 to 26 weeks. The largest variables are permitting, AHJ inspections, geotechnical investigation, foundation cure time, and steel-fabrication lead time. Twin Eagle Solutions provides a project schedule at kickoff and a weekly status update for the duration.
Do you handle FAA and FCC paperwork?
Yes. FAA Part 77 obstruction-evaluation filings, FAA AC 70/7460-1 marking and lighting determination, and FCC Antenna Structure Registration (ASR) when required are filed and tracked by Twin Eagle as part of the program. Marking and lighting are installed and verified to the FAA determination.
What about permitting and environmental review?
Local AHJ building and zoning permitting, NEPA environmental review where applicable, SHPO/THPO consultations for cultural-resource clearance, and FCC NEPA-equivalent review (Sections 1.1307/1.1311) are all coordinated by Twin Eagle's permitting partners under the project plan. Twin Eagle is the customer's point of contact for all of it.
What documentation do we receive at handover?
A complete as-built documentation package: stamped structural and foundation drawings, geotech report, FAA filings, FCC ASR registration where applicable, AHJ permits and inspection records, concrete pour and anchor torque records, plumb-and-twist verification, bolt-torque QA, RF sweep reports, lightning-protection and grounding test records, photo documentation, warranty documentation, and a final walkdown report — delivered as both a physical binder and a digital archive.
